EK 2s had a home match againbst Helensburgh 2s today in a match that counted as a double header making up for the previously postponed home and away matches between both sides.
Helensburgh started strongly but could not find the tryline, unlike EK who took an early lead through tries by Craig Ferguson (Fat but Slimmer) and Ross Stewart. This was followed up by another EK try through the centre.
The lead was increased, securing the try bonus point x 2, through veteran but ever energetic John Watson who scored under the posts. Flanker Calum Aitken got the next score which he duly converted to make the half time score 33-0.
The 2nd half was a more sluggish affair, with Craig (Fat) Ferguson getting the first score on the left. This led to the highlight of the day.
Flanker Aitken, who had been kicking well all day, had an off moment which saw his conversion attempt hit the right corner flag! This confirmed his reputation as a "wide boy" and greatly cheered the crowd. Score: 38-0.
A "Celtic style" huddle by the Helensburgh forwards stirred them to score the next try. EK scored next with stand off Scott Johnston surprising everyone, possibly including himself, with a superb conversion from the touchline.
Motivated by a short rest, EK got their final unconverted try through Fat Fergie. But the visitors had the last word, with a converted try under the posts.
This was a good display by EK, Man of the Match: Andy Kampman for his all action display, including numerous superb tackles.
